Todays drop in the unemployment rate is positive, but we
are also very focused on the fall in payroll employment.
This marks the second straight month the unemployment rate has
declined. Employment is always a lagging indicator in an economic recovery. The
economy is showing many signs of strength and improvement including increased
productivity that will ultimately lead to more jobs. Stronger-than-expected
economic growth, an increase in manufacturing and construction activity and
increased consumer confidence all show that the Presidents Jobs and
Growth plan is already having a positive effect, and that means more Americans
will soon be finding good jobs.
New jobs are being created in health and education services,
temporary help services and construction. Construction employment has increased
for the sixth consecutive month, gaining 122,000 jobs since February.
